Output 8dfaa864d4f137b1bcc522ba6cebf353de3670f1807e60e687d0abae17402954:6

value
1358523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4128a04880ed8788915e8a2cd3b70730a327c363 OP_EQUAL
address
37dYWmGdegS6MQLDgSEcsz8Qo62ZUEbvMA
transaction
8dfaa864d4f137b1bcc522ba6cebf353de3670f1807e60e687d0abae17402954
spent
true